Verlauf
OnionCat is a long-running networking experiment that maps Tor hidden services or I2P tunnels into an IPv6 TUN interface. It makes onion/I2P endpoints look like peers on an IP network, so ordinary IP-based protocols can travel over Tor or I2P hidden-service transports.
OnionCat development began in 2008, when Tor hidden-service v2 identifiers were short enough to be reversibly mapped into IPv6 addresses under a special prefix. Its own documentation describes the core trick as translating between OnionCat IPv6 addresses and .onion hostnames, then forwarding packets between a local TUN device and remote OnionCat peers.
The move from Tor v2 hidden services to v3 onion services challenged OnionCat's original design because v3 identifiers no longer fit inside an IPv6 address. OnionCat4 added lookup machinery to preserve the virtual-network model after the identifier-size change.
OnionCat has been packaged beyond a single ecosystem: Debian documented an ocat(1) man page by the Jessie era, and Homebrew packages onioncat for macOS and Linux users. Its GitHub repository is the official upstream and had an onioncat-4.11.0 release dated March 9, 2023.
Users run ocat with a local onion or I2P identifier, and OnionCat opens a TUN device, assigns it a derived IPv6 address, and relays packets through Tor or I2P. The tool can carry TCP, UDP, and other IP-based traffic, making it resemble a peer-to-peer VPN between hidden services rather than a web-only Tor client.
The README also exposes OnionCat's operational rough edges: it is a userland connector, depends on Tor/I2P setup, and does not add its own encryption on top of the transport. That makes it a tool for operators who understand the underlying anonymity network rather than a general-purpose consumer VPN.
OnionCat matters because it is one of the more literal attempts to package 'IP over onion services' as a Unix-style command. It combines old-school TUN-device networking, IPv6 address mapping, Tor/I2P naming, and distro packaging into a compact but unusual formula.
